Insurance via super

Protect what you're building

Insurance provides an important financial safety net for you and your family in the event of unforeseen circumstances. Depending on your super fund, you may be able to save money by taking advantage of some cost-effective insurance options.

The most common insurance options on offer through super funds are:

  • Death cover: provides a lump sum payout, in addition to your super account balance, if you die while still a member of the fund
  • Total and permanent disablement cover: provides a lump sum payout if you become totally and permanently disabled
  • Income protection cover: provides you with a replacement income if you are unable to work for an extended period of time, usually a month or more, although some policies will cover you after two weeks
